Output fd686b8c13b9097da7d9e632b262ccaef6ee97b788e79bf92c4e16fadaf68d9c:24

value
1236543
script pubkey
OP_0 OP_PUSHBYTES_20 dffa91bc41eb5970fc3c85839ab11e284cbc2f2f
address
bc1qmlafr0zpadvhplpuskpe4vg79pxtcte0gt5rs8
transaction
fd686b8c13b9097da7d9e632b262ccaef6ee97b788e79bf92c4e16fadaf68d9c
confirmations
98221
spent
true